State housing agency releases first funds under $500 million of new bond authority for first time homebuyers

AUSTIN, TX – May 21, 2010 – (RealEstateRama) — The Texas Department of Housing and Community Affairs (TDHCA) announced that beginning today the State will make available the first $50 million under an unprecedented $500 million in new mortgage revenue bond authority.

The Texas Department of Housing and Community Affairs (TDHCA) is the state agency responsible for affordable housing, community services, energy assistance, and colonia housing programs. The Department annually administers more than $400 million through for-profit, nonprofit, and local government partnerships to deliver local housing and community-based opportunities and assistance to Texans in need.
